Description

Healthy Chicken Lettuce Wraps are a light, low-carb meal packed with lean protein, fresh vegetables, and a flavorful savory sauce. These quick wraps are perfect for meal prep, lunch, or a refreshing dinner option.


Ingredients

Scale
  • 2 cups chicken breast, finely chopped or ground
  • 1 tablespoon olive oil
  • 3 cloves garlic, minced
  • 1 tablespoon fresh ginger, grated
  • 3 tablespoons soy sauce
  • 2 tablespoons hoisin sauce
  • 1 teaspoon sesame oil
  • 1 tablespoon rice vinegar
  • 1 tablespoon honey
  • 1/2 cup green onions, chopped
  • 1/2 cup water chestnuts, chopped
  • 1/2 cup carrots, shredded
  • 1/2 cup bell peppers, finely diced
  • 12 large lettuce leaves (butter or iceberg)
  • 1 teaspoon sesame seeds
  • 1/2 teaspoon chili flakes (optional)

Instructions

1. Heat olive oil in a skillet over medium heat.

2. Add garlic and ginger, sauté for 30–45 seconds until fragrant.

3. Add chicken and cook for 5–7 minutes, breaking it apart until fully cooked.

4. Stir in soy sauce, hoisin sauce, sesame oil, rice vinegar, and honey.

5. Simmer for 2–3 minutes until sauce thickens slightly.

6. Add water chestnuts, carrots, and bell peppers.

7. Cook for another 2–3 minutes while keeping vegetables slightly crisp.

8. Remove from heat and stir in green onions and chili flakes.

9. Wash and dry lettuce leaves carefully.

10. Spoon chicken mixture into each lettuce leaf.

11. Sprinkle with sesame seeds and serve immediately.

Notes

  • Use ground chicken for quicker cooking.
  • Keep lettuce leaves dry to maintain crisp texture.
  • Adjust sweetness or saltiness by modifying sauce amounts.
  • Store filling separately from lettuce for meal prep.
  • Add chopped peanuts or cashews for extra crunch.

Nutrition

  • Serving Size: 3 wraps
  • Calories: 250–350
  • Sugar: 6g
  • Sodium: 650mg
  • Fat: 12g
  • Saturated Fat: 2g
  • Unsaturated Fat: 9g
  • Trans Fat: 0g
  • Carbohydrates: 15g
  • Fiber: 3g
  • Protein: 28g
  • Cholesterol: 70mg

How to Make It (Step-by-Step Method)

Begin by heating olive oil in a large skillet over medium heat. Once hot, add the minced garlic and grated ginger. Sauté for about 30–45 seconds until fragrant—this forms the aromatic base of your dish.

Add the finely chopped or ground chicken to the skillet. Break it apart using a spatula and cook for about 5–7 minutes until fully cooked and lightly browned. The chicken should be tender with slightly golden edges.

Stir in the soy sauce, hoisin sauce, sesame oil, rice vinegar, and honey. Mix well so the chicken absorbs all the flavors. Let it simmer for 2–3 minutes until the sauce thickens slightly and coats the chicken evenly.

Add the chopped water chestnuts, shredded carrots, and diced bell peppers. Cook for another 2–3 minutes, just enough to soften them slightly while still maintaining their crunch. This balance of textures is key to great lettuce wraps.

Turn off the heat and stir in the chopped green onions and chili flakes if using. Taste and adjust seasoning if needed.

Carefully separate and wash your lettuce leaves, then pat them dry. Choose large, intact leaves that can hold the filling without tearing.

To assemble, spoon a generous portion of the chicken mixture into the center of each lettuce leaf. Sprinkle with sesame seeds for a finishing touch.

Serve immediately while the filling is warm and the lettuce is crisp.

Serving Suggestions

These healthy chicken lettuce wraps are incredibly versatile and visually appealing when served thoughtfully. For a fresh and inviting presentation, arrange the lettuce leaves on a large platter and place the warm chicken filling in a bowl at the center. This allows everyone to build their own wraps, making it perfect for family dinners or casual gatherings. Add small bowls of toppings like extra green onions, sesame seeds, chopped peanuts, or even a drizzle of spicy sauce so each person can customize their wrap to their taste.

If you’re serving these as a main meal, consider pairing them with a light side such as steamed jasmine rice, quinoa, or a simple cucumber salad. The cool, refreshing sides complement the savory chicken filling beautifully. For a more modern twist, you can also turn this dish into a lettuce wrap bowl—layer the chicken mixture over a bed of greens or grains and top with crunchy vegetables and herbs.

For lunchboxes or meal prep, pack the chicken filling separately from the lettuce leaves. This keeps everything fresh and crisp until you’re ready to eat. When assembled just before serving, the wraps maintain their perfect texture and flavor, making them just as enjoyable as when freshly made.

Storage + Meal Prep

These lettuce wraps are ideal for meal prep and can easily fit into a healthy weekly routine. Store the cooked chicken filling in an airtight container in the refrigerator for up to 4 days. The flavors actually deepen over time, making leftovers even more delicious.

Keep the lettuce leaves washed, dried, and stored separately in a container lined with paper towels to absorb moisture and maintain crispness. This prevents them from becoming soggy and ensures they’re ready to use at any time.

When reheating, warm only the chicken filling in a skillet or microwave until heated through. Avoid overheating, as this can dry out the chicken. If needed, add a splash of water or a bit of extra sauce to keep it moist.

Freezing is also an option for the chicken filling. Store it in a freezer-safe container for up to 2 months. When ready to use, thaw overnight in the refrigerator and reheat gently.

For best results, always assemble the wraps fresh. Add toppings like sesame seeds or fresh herbs just before serving to maintain their texture and flavor.
